用sql建立一个学生表
时间: 2024-09-28 20:07:42 浏览: 20
在SQL中,创建一个学生表(Student Table)的基本结构通常包括学生的个人信息、学籍信息以及可能的其他相关数据。下面是一个简单的例子,展示如何使用SQL创建这样的表:
```sql
CREATE TABLE Students (
ID INT PRIMARY KEY,
FirstName VARCHAR(50) NOT NULL,
LastName VARCHAR(50) NOT NULL,
DateOfBirth DATE,
Gender ENUM('Male', 'Female'),
Major VARCHAR(100),
Grade INT,
Email VARCHAR(100) UNIQUE,
Address VARCHAR(200)
);
```
在这个例子中:
- `ID` 是主键,用于唯一标识每个学生。
- `FirstName` 和 `LastName` 分别表示学生的姓名。
- `DateOfBirth` 存储学生的出生日期。
- `Gender` 是一个枚举类型,存储学生的性别。
- `Major` 学生的专业。
- `Grade` 学生的年级。
- `Email` 是唯一的,用来区分不同的学生。
- `Address` 存储学生的住址。
相关问题
用sql建立一个学生表student
好的,可以使用以下SQL语句建立一个学生表student:
CREATE TABLE student (
id INT PRIMARY KEY,
name VARCHAR(50),
age INT,
gender VARCHAR(10),
grade INT
);
这个表包含了学生的id、姓名、年龄、性别和年级等信息。
用sql语言建立一个学生表
好的,以下是建立学生表的 SQL 语句:
CREATE TABLE student (
id INT PRIMARY KEY,
name VARCHAR(50),
age INT,
gender VARCHAR(10),
major VARCHAR(50),
grade INT
);
以上 SQL 语句将创建一个名为 student 的表,包含 id、name、age、gender、major 和 grade 六个字段。其中,id 字段为主键,保证每个学生的 id 值唯一。